I wouldn't trust a non-timed, GPS'd, or radar'd speed on a NA.

I believe 8k RPM in 4th gear with normal tires gives you 135mph or so, and you slow down in 5th because the engine doesn't have the power to go any faster - that's why a TII is faster, it can wind out 5th.
